Hey kelly. had to upgrade mine to v2.00 also before downgrading. If your psp came with v1.51 then the demo disk you got with it should have v2.00 on it. So all you need to do is run 'psp update version 2.00' from the demo disk. Make sure it is 2.00 and not 2.01 or higher! Then just do the downgrade. Hope this helps.

ok,

sorted just upgraded, anyone got the same problem as me use this v2 eboot file

http://files.pspupdates.qj.net/cgi-bin/cfiles.cgi?0,1,0,0,40,1480,

and simply rename it to eboot.pbp and then place it in a PSP>GAME>UPDATE, then back out from usb mode , via psp scroll across to game and then memory stick and click on the file and follow the on screen instructions.
